引言

系统分析师是信息技术领域中的重要角色,他们负责分析和设计信息系统以满足组织的需求。成为一名优秀的系统分析师需要掌握一系列的技能和知识。本文将揭秘系统分析师高通过率背后的秘密,通过实战技巧与案例分析,帮助读者提升自己的能力。

一、系统分析师的核心技能

1.1 分析与设计能力

系统分析师需要具备出色的分析能力,能够理解业务需求,并将其转化为清晰的技术解决方案。设计能力则是将分析结果转化为具体的系统架构和流程。

1.2 技术知识

系统分析师应熟悉各种编程语言、数据库管理、网络技术等基础知识。同时,对新兴技术和行业趋势也要有一定的了解。

1.3 沟通与协作

系统分析师需要与项目团队成员、业务用户、管理层等多方进行有效沟通。良好的沟通和协作能力有助于项目的顺利进行。

二、实战技巧

2.1 业务理解

深入了解业务流程和需求,是系统分析师成功的关键。以下是一些提高业务理解能力的技巧:

  • 与业务用户进行面对面交流,了解他们的痛点和需求。
  • 参与业务培训,提高对业务领域的认识。
  • 使用业务流程图和案例来加深对业务的理解。

2.2 系统设计

在设计系统时,以下技巧有助于提高成功率:

  • 使用UML(统一建模语言)进行系统设计,提高设计的可读性和可维护性。
  • 采用迭代开发方法,逐步完善系统功能。
  • 进行充分的需求分析,确保设计符合用户需求。

2.3 技术选型

在技术选型过程中,以下技巧有助于做出明智的选择:

  • 考虑技术的成熟度、社区支持、成本等因素。
  • 尝试使用开源技术,降低项目成本。
  • 遵循最佳实践,避免技术陷阱。

2.4 沟通与协作

以下技巧有助于提高沟通与协作能力:

  • 建立良好的团队关系,促进团队合作。
  • 使用项目管理工具,提高团队协作效率。
  • 善于倾听,尊重他人的意见。

三、案例分析

3.1 案例一:某企业CRM系统开发

背景:某企业希望开发一套CRM系统,提高客户管理效率。 解决方案:系统分析师通过深入了解企业业务流程,与业务用户进行沟通,最终设计出一套符合企业需求的CRM系统。 结果:系统上线后,客户管理效率得到显著提升,企业业绩有所增长。

3.2 案例二:某电商平台系统优化

背景:某电商平台希望提高系统性能,降低用户等待时间。 解决方案:系统分析师对现有系统进行性能分析,发现瓶颈所在,并提出优化方案。 结果:系统优化后,用户等待时间明显缩短,用户体验得到提升。

四、总结

系统分析师高通过率背后的秘密在于他们具备扎实的技能、丰富的实战经验和良好的沟通能力。通过本文的实战技巧与案例分析,相信读者能够更好地提升自己的能力,在系统分析师的道路上越走越远。